Republican President, Michael Sata has not yet shifted to state house, Tumfweko understands.
Tumfweko has understood that President Michael Sata’s attitude towards issues of his security is worrying security and intelligence government experts.
Sources close to State House stated that Mr. Sata remains at Omelo Mumba Road, in Rhodespark as government renovates State House to suit his taste and that of the First Lady, Dr. Christine Kaseba.
Omelo Mumba Road has been sectioned off with barrier booms 21 days after Mr.Sata was elected and his private home is flying Zambia’s orange and green flag to symbolise the presence of the republican president.
Mr. Sata has also reduced the police that line up the presidential route and has significantly scaled down his motorcade claiming is man of the people.
Sources also disclosed that Mr. Sata intends to visit the teaming town centre as soon as his schedule is eases up.
The security advisors are concerned that although the president is very popular especially in urban areas, his strong shift on policy matters relating to foreign policies and his anti-corruption drive brings significant risks to his presidency.
‘’China has invested billions of dollars in this country and now the President has announced that the country will shift its attention and investment to the West,” the source feared, “we can’t take risks, also the anti- corruption drive against his predecessors and the former officials remain powerful”.”
“Further we need to worry when we see the country begin to lose relations with Angola and Malawi, it concerns us,” said the source.
‘’We have no evidence that anyone or any country is planning anything untoward against the president, but our duty is to understand anything that will bring risks to the presidency and act accordingly,”the source disclosed.
